How seismic is this area?

Zone3
Seismic zone 3

Medium-low seismicity: strong quakes are rare, but not impossible.

Official Civil Protection classification (upd. 2025), used for building codes.

Low
Expected shaking, compared with the other Italian municipalities (INGV MPS04 model)

Hazard describes the long-term expected shaking: it is not a forecast. Technical value: ag = 0.086 g (10% probability of exceedance in 50 years, rigid soil).

The seismic history of Viguzzolo

The earthquakes that were actually felt in Viguzzolo over the centuries, with the intensity observed on site (Mercalli MCS scale).

  1. 2003V11 April 2003

    Rather strong: felt by almost everyone; hanging objects swing.

    Valle Scrivia earthquake (M4.8), epicentre 18 km away

  2. 1914SF27 October 1914

    Light: felt by few people, like a passing truck.

    Lucchesia earthquake (M5.6), epicentre 174 km away

  3. 1905NF29 April 1905

    Imperceptible: only instruments record it.

    Haute-Savoie, Vallorcine earthquake (M5.1), epicentre 193 km away

  4. 1887V23 February 1887

    Rather strong: felt by almost everyone; hanging objects swing.

    Liguria occidentale earthquake (M6.3), epicentre 136 km away

Source: Italian Macroseismic Database DBMI15 (INGV, CC BY 4.0).

The closest seismic structure

Eastern Monferrato

The town sits above this source area: the deep structure where this area's earthquakes can originate.

estimated maximum magnitude 6.4between 1 and 8 km deep

Faults are mapped to build better and understand the territory: knowing them says nothing about when an earthquake will occur, which remains unpredictable. Source: DISS 3.3 (INGV, CC BY 4.0).
